Nathan James a565509308
[ADT] Use Empty Base Optimization for Allocators
In D94439, BumpPtrAllocator changed its implementation to use an empty base optimization for the underlying allocator.
This patch builds on that by extending its functionality to more classes as well as enabling the underlying allocator to be a reference type, something not currently possible as you can't derive from a reference.

The main place this sees use is in StringMaps which often use the default MallocAllocator, yet have to pay the size of a pointer for no reason.

Nathan James 638b0fb4d6
[ADT][NFC] Early bail out for ComputeEditDistance
The minimun bound for number of edits is the size difference between the 2 arrays.
If MaxEditDistance is smaller than this, we can bail out early without needing to traverse any of the arrays.

Krzysztof Parzyszek aee6b8efd0 [ADT] Explicitly delete copy/move constructors and operator= in IntervalMap
The default implementations will perform a shallow copy instead of a deep
copy, causing some internal data structures to be shared between different
objects. Disable these operations so they don't get accidentally used.

Jay Foad 169ae6db69 [APInt] Allow extending and truncating to the same width
Allow zext, sext, trunc, truncUSat and truncSSat to extend or truncate
to the same bit width, which is a no-op.

Disallowing this forced clients to use workarounds like using
zextOrTrunc (even though they never wanted truncation) or zextOrSelf
(even though they did not want its strange behaviour of allowing a
*smaller* bit width, which is also treated as a no-op).

Chris Bieneman 9130e471fe Add DXContainer
DXIL is wrapped in a container format defined by the DirectX 11
specification. Codebases differ in calling this format either DXBC or
DXILContainer.

Since eventually we want to add support for DXBC as a target
architecture and the format is used by DXBC and DXIL, I've termed it
DXContainer here.

Most of the changes in this patch are just adding cases to switch
statements to address warnings.

Amilendra Kodithuwakku 1f08b08674 [clang][ARM] Emit warnings when PACBTI-M is used with unsupported architectures
Branch protection in M-class is supported by
 - Armv8.1-M.Main
 - Armv8-M.Main
 - Armv7-M

Attempting to enable this for other architectures, either by
command-line (e.g -mbranch-protection=bti) or by target attribute
in source code (e.g.  __attribute__((target("branch-protection=..."))) )
will generate a warning.

In both cases function attributes related to branch protection will not
be emitted. Regardless of the warning, module level attributes related to
branch protection will be emitted when it is enabled via the command-line.

Jan Svoboda 622354a522 [llvm][ADT] Implement `BitVector::{pop_,}back`
LLVM Programmer’s Manual strongly discourages the use of `std::vector<bool>` and suggests `llvm::BitVector` as a possible replacement.

Currently, some users of `std::vector<bool>` cannot switch to `llvm::BitVector` because it doesn't implement the `pop_back()` and `back()` functions.

To enable easy transition of `std::vector<bool>` users, this patch implements `llvm::BitVector::pop_back()` and `llvm::BitVector::back()`.
